Description
When the New Year began at midnight January 1, 1931, the historic Glendale-Montrose Railway ended as Joseph Hingston, at left, and William Nagel, at right, took the last car on the last run. Nagel had been with the line since it began 21 years ago, and Hingston was the second oldest employee in point of service.
